State Street Corporation, established in 1792 and headquartered in Boston, Massachusetts, is one of the oldest financial institutions in the United States and a major player in the global asset management and custody banking sectors. Primarily known for its custodial services, it safeguards assets for institutional investors, managing trillions of dollars through its State Street Global Advisors (SSGA) division, which is renowned for launching the first U.S. exchange-traded fund (ETF), the SPDR S&P 500 ETF (SPY), in 1993. The company provides a range of services including investment management, research, trading, and data analytics, catering mostly to institutional clients like pension funds, endowments, and mutual funds. With a focus on financial infrastructure and innovation, State Street has positioned itself as a key backbone in the global investment ecosystem.

State Street's Q1 2015 Portfolio in Review

As of Q1 2015, State Street held 3,759 positions worth $974B, down 2.9% from $1T the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 15% of the portfolio.

State Street withdrew a net $37.6B in Q1 2015, closing 81 positions and reducing 1,259 holdings. Its most notable exit was Allergan Inc, an estimated $2.68B position sold in full.

By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Financials at 15% of assets, down from 16% a quarter earlier, followed by Healthcare and Technology.

Against the trend, State Street opened a new position in Qorvo worth $458M.
